One of the standout features of Dallas County’s real estate market is its stunning collection of homes showcasing Spanish architectural style. These homes, often characterized by their red-tiled roofs, stucco exteriors, and intricate wrought-iron details, exude a warm, inviting charm that transports you to the sun-soaked landscapes of Spain. Inside, you’ll find open floor plans, arched doorways, and vibrant tile work that add character and elegance to each space.
